## Runbook: Spoolgnome printer-spooler stuck jobs

If jobs pile up in the Spoolgnome queue, first restart the worker pod — fixes it 90% of the time. Still stuck? Purge the queue via the admin endpoint and let clients resubmit. The purge call needs auth against the Inkwarden service, and the key you'll want is right below.

service key, fawip-bajef: kto11_Qt5wZK9vdNC

# Bouncehawk Environments

Bouncehawk is our email bounce processor, and yes, it has three environments that behave just differently enough to bite you. Dev uses a fake SMTP sink, staging talks to the Pellworth relay with throttling on, and prod consumes the real feedback loop queue. Hard bounces suppress immediately; soft bounces retry on a backoff schedule that staging shortens for testing. If a queue backs up, check the consumer lag first before restarting anything. Staging currently runs with the following settings.

deployment values, yadug-bawif:
[framir]
team = pelox
access_code = ac_a38ab2
owner = tamion.julael
host = framir.tolvaqlabs.test
port = 11211
peer = tammir.zemvargrid.local
salt = 2215ef03
pin = 1541

## Deployment: Connection Pooling

The Brindlemere API maintains a shared pool to its Postgres-compatible backend via the Oxhollow proxy. Sizing matters: too small and request latency spikes under load; too large and the database exhausts its connection slots during deploys, since two replica sets overlap briefly. After provisioning the database, set the pool parameters below before the first rollout.

service settings:
[oliix]
team = noveth
access_code = ac_4de949
host = oliix.novachq.corp
port = 8080
owner = wenir.casion
peer = wenys.lumicstack.corp

Subject: Legacy Pricing Adjustment — Briefing for Incoming Director

Team,

As Dana Vreel joins next week, a quick summary: Bramblewick Software will raise legacy-contract pricing by 9% effective Q2, affecting customers on pre-2021 Harborline plans. Notifications go out thirty days ahead; retention offers are prepared for the top accounts. Projected uplift is modest but durable, and churn modelling indicates acceptable risk. Support scripts are finalised. The broader commercial context is captured in the confidential note below.

— Marek Oduya

internal memo for kawip-hadug: Headcount on the Wenwyn team goes from 7 to 140 by the end of January. Gross margin on Wenwyn came in at 20 percent against a plan of 15 percent.